Greg Waldorf
Angel · San Francisco, California, United States

Greg Waldorf is a Lecturer at Stanford Graduate School of Business and the former CEO of Invoice2go, the mobile app that helps small businesses manage their cash flow through easy-to-use invoicing, expense tracking and simple reporting tools. He has a long history of involvement with leading technology businesses. Prior to joining Invoice2go, Gregwas affiliated with Accel Partners as CEO-in-residence. Greg also served as CEO of eHarmony for five years from 2006-2010 where he drove significant global growth through an expansion to 15 countries worldwide.He holds a BA from University of California, Los Angeles and an MBA from Stanford University.

Biola Alabi
Angel

Biola Alabi is the Managing Partner of Biola Alabi Media, the media icon heads a dynamic consultancy and production company with expertise in strategic consulting for pay entertainment, digital television, interactive television and emerging entertainment distribution platforms; they service governments, content creators, telecommunicationindustry, and investors in the converging media technology space. Biola Alabi Media productions has recently produced Nigeria’s first food travel documentary-series "Bukas and Joints" currently airing across Africa and in the USA.She is also the founder of "Grooming for Greatness" a leadership development and mentorship program for a new generation of African leaders. Named one of the 20 Youngest Power Women in Africa by Forbes Magazine (2012), a World Economic Forum Young Global Leader (2012) and CNBC Africa’s AABLA West African Business Woman of the Year (2013), for over five highly successful years, Biola Alabi held the high-profile position of Managing Director for M-Net Africa, part of the globally renowned Naspers Group. Prior to this, she was based in the United States where she was part of the executive team at the influential children’s television brand Sesame Street and a member of the marketing team that launched the well-respected Korean motor vehicle corporation Daewoo in the USA.
